Modelling Techniques II
FA-MT2Acad. year: 2011/2012
The subject develops the creative ability to treat a spatial idea in a concrete material and technology. Its contents derives from the functional or formal analysis of the organic principle. The objective is to develop the ability to use the sources of inspiration in the search for formal ideas, and their presentation. Emphasis is put on the technology of implementation (work on 3D machines of the Modelling Centre) and its application to architecture. The classes are combined with the classes of computer art and of free creative activity in the Institute of Drawing and Modelling, in the winter semester.
